"Mellifluens" derives itself from the Latin words "mel" (honey) and "fluō" (to flow),
which then becomes translated to "flowing with honey" or "honeyed".
This metaphorical adjective is best used to describe someone or something
that is sweet, pleasing, or endearing. I honestly had no clue what to call this website
